Role Overview
We are seeking a motivated Leasing Professional to support leasing operations at our multifamily community. This role focuses on sales leasing resident service and occupancy by converting prospects into residents conducting property tours processing applications and maintaining accurate leasing records.
Key Responsibilities
- Respond to prospective resident inquiries by phone email and other communication channels and conduct timely follow-ups.
- Conduct property tours and effectively present available apartments amenities pricing lease terms and community features.
- Manage the leasing process from initial inquiry through application approval lease execution and move-in.
- Process rental applications and maintain accurate prospect and resident information in CRM and property management systems.
- Follow up with prospects consistently to generate applications improve conversion and support occupancy goals.
- Assist with lease renewals resident retention transfers and other leasing-related activities.
- Provide professional customer service and respond to resident questions regarding leases payments maintenance and community policies.
- Coordinate with maintenance and property management teams to ensure resident concerns are addressed promptly.
- Maintain accurate leasing records reports documentation and prospect activity.
- Support marketing outreach resident events and other initiatives designed to generate leasing traffic.
- Follow Fair Housing LIHTC company and property-specific compliance requirements.
- Meet established leasing sales follow-up and occupancy goals.
